Peskov: the parameters of the plan have been transferred to the Russian Federation
![]() 1212 Friday, 28 November, 2025, 15:12 Russia has received the main parameters of the peace framework discussed by U.S. and Ukrainian negotiators in Geneva, Kremlin spokesperson Dmitry Peskov said on Nov. 28. "There will be talks in Moscow next week," the spokesperson added. His statement came as U.S. special envoy Steve Witkoff is expected to travel to Moscow for meetings with Russian President Vladimir Putin.
